A
lgorithmique
N
umérique
D
istribuée
Public GIT Repository
projects
/
simgrid.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
add clean-atexit test
[simgrid.git]
/
src
/
simdag
/
sd_global.cpp
diff --git
a/src/simdag/sd_global.cpp
b/src/simdag/sd_global.cpp
index
ad85c0f
..
fe90776
100644
(file)
--- a/
src/simdag/sd_global.cpp
+++ b/
src/simdag/sd_global.cpp
@@
-152,7
+152,7
@@
const char *__get_state_name(e_SD_task_state_t state){
* \param argv argument list
* \see SD_create_environment(), SD_exit()
*/
* \param argv argument list
* \see SD_create_environment(), SD_exit()
*/
-void SD_init
_check
(int *argc, char **argv)
+void SD_init(int *argc, char **argv)
{
xbt_assert(sd_global == nullptr, "SD_init() already called");
{
xbt_assert(sd_global == nullptr, "SD_init() already called");
@@
-161,6
+161,7
@@
void SD_init_check(int *argc, char **argv)
surf_init(argc, argv);
xbt_cfg_setdefault_string("host/model", "ptask_L07");
surf_init(argc, argv);
xbt_cfg_setdefault_string("host/model", "ptask_L07");
+ if(xbt_cfg_get_boolean("clean-atexit"))
atexit(SD_exit);
if (_sg_cfg_exit_asap) {
exit(0);
atexit(SD_exit);
if (_sg_cfg_exit_asap) {
exit(0);